BILL Holdings (NYSE:BILL) stock surged 32% on Friday, following reports that private equity firm Hellman & Friedman has entered discussions to acquire the business payments company. This gain adds to a previous 21% climb that followed the company's recent quarterly results, signaling strong investor confidence.
According to reports, Hellman & Friedman has been actively engaging with BILL Holdings and its financial advisers in a formal sale process. The discussions are not exclusive, as other private equity firms have also reportedly expressed interest in a potential acquisition. This move comes as BILL Holdings faces mounting pressure from activist investors, including notable firms like Starboard Value LP and Elliott Investment Management.
The news of a potential takeover has significantly boosted the company's market valuation. The sharp increase in stock price reflects investor speculation that a sale could result in a premium price for shareholders. The market is reacting positively to the possibility of a strategic change for the payments company.
The acquisition interest from Hellman & Friedman and other firms, fueled by activist investor pressure, has created substantial upward momentum for BILL's stock.
